While we have always discouraged cars in the back streets, with so many people waiting on the roads and footpaths, it is even more important to heed this safety advice.
There have also been some issues with the “kiss & drop” zone on Gladstone Road.

With more cars using this area again, some cars are lining up (parking) illegally, going around the corner onto Prospect Road.
If the line around the corner is full you must not stop in this area. If we all work together, we create a system that is as safe as possible, for the movement of children at the beginning and end of the day.
